About the job Sr. Java Developer (10+ Years)
This position is for a Senior Java Developer who will be working on design and development of web / mobile applications. The individual will be responsible for developing, implementing, maintaining, and supporting Java based components and interfaces. The position requires broad understanding of various coding methodologies, testing practice, and tools and accordingly apply each method to achieve the desired outcomes.
The ideal candidate must display excellent written and oral skills with demonstrated interpersonal and organization abilities and must be able to work in a varied, fast pa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Supports the entire SDLC including support and maintenance.
- Responsible for code asset management for applications, as well as support and promoting asset reuse.
- Performs unit / integrated completed system testing according to detailed functional specification.
- Supports the implementation of systems into production.
- Assists team members performing system maintenance, and support tasks.
- Utilizes accepted methodologies and tools in a disciplined manner.
- Works independently and efficiently to meet deadlines.
